Professional Judgment
The ability to make decisions and draw conclusions in one’s professional field based on expertise, experience, and ethics.
Exploiting the Client
Acting unethically by taking unfair advantage of a client for personal, financial, or other gains, contradicting professional ethical standards.
Dual Relationship
Ethical dilemma arising when a professional holds more than one role with a client, potentially compromising objectivity and confidentiality.
Family History
A record of a person's background including health, genetic conditions, and relationships within the family.
